Demographics details for Bedford, VA vs Monroe, LA

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Bedford, VA vs Monroe, LA.

Data Bedford Monroe
Population 6,735 46,820
Median Age 40.5 years 34.3 years
Median Income $41,154 $36,550
Married Families 32.0% 23.0%
Poverty Level 10% 24%
Unemployment Rate 3.5 5.9

Population Comparison: Bedford vs Monroe

  • The population in Monroe is higher at 46,820, compared to 6,735 in Bedford.
  • Residents in Bedford have a higher median age of 40.5 years compared to 34.3 years in Monroe.
  • Bedford has a higher median income of $41,154 compared to $36,550 in Monroe.
  • A higher percentage of married families is found in Bedford at 32.0% compared to 23.0% in Monroe.
  • The poverty level is higher in Monroe at 24%, compared to 10% in Bedford.
  • Monroe has a higher unemployment rate at 5.9% compared to 3.5% in Bedford.

Demographics

Demographics Bedford vs Monroe provide insight into the diversity of the communities to compare.

Demographic Bedford Monroe
Black 17 62
White 75 33
Asian 3 2
Hispanic 2 2
Two or More Races 3 1
American Indian Data is updating Data is updating

Demographics Comparison: Bedford vs Monroe

  • In Monroe, the percentage of Black residents is higher at 62% compared to 17% in Bedford.
  • Bedford has a higher percentage of White residents at 75% compared to 33% in Monroe.
  • The Asian population is larger in Bedford at 3% compared to 2% in Monroe.
  • The percentage of Hispanic residents is the same in both Bedford and Monroe at 2%.
  • More residents identify as two or more races in Bedford at 3% compared to 1% in Monroe.
  • The percentage of American Indian residents is the same in both Bedford and Monroe at 0%.

Health Statistics

The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.

Health Metric Bedford Monroe
Mental Health Not Good 19.9% 21.1%
Physical Health Not Good 14.0% 16.0%
Depression 25.4% 23.8%
Smoking 21.9% 26.0%
Binge Drinking 15.7% 14.3%
Obesity 41.8% 41.9%
Disability Percentage 11.0% 13.0%

Health Statistics Comparison: Bedford vs Monroe

  • In Monroe,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 21.1% compared to 19.9% in Bedford.
  • Depression is more prevalent in Bedford at 25.4% compared to 23.8% in Monroe.
  • Monroe has a higher smoking rate at 26.0% compared to 21.9% in Bedford.
  • Binge drinking is more common in Bedford at 15.7% compared to 14.3% in Monroe.
  • Monroe has higher obesity rates at 41.9% compared to 41.8% in Bedford.
  • There is a higher percentage of disabled individuals in Monroe at 13.0% compared to 11.0% in Bedford.

Education Levels

The educational attainment in the area helps gauge the workforce's skill level and economic potential.

Education Level Bedford Monroe
No Schooling 1.3% (87) 0.7% (320)
High School Diploma 22.5% (1,518) 16.8% (7,877)
Less than High School 19.7% (1,324) 10.9% (5,106)
Bachelor's Degree and Higher 13.5% (909) 17.1% (8,014)

Education Levels Comparison: Bedford vs Monroe

  • A higher percentage of residents in Bedford have no formal schooling at 1.3% compared to 0.7% in Monroe.
  • A higher percentage of residents in Bedford hold a high school diploma at 22.5% compared to 16.8% in Monroe.
  • More residents in Bedford have less than a high school education at 19.7% compared to 10.9% in Monroe.
  • In Monroe, a larger share of residents have a bachelor's degree or higher at 17.1% compared to 13.5% in Bedford.
